On Thursday, March 3, 2025, the team from Universal Television (UTV) Africa visited Chukwuemeka Odumegwu Ojukwu University (COOU) in Anambra State to interact with beneficiaries of the Nigerian Education Loan Fund (NELFUND).
The visit aimed to gather feedback from students who recently received refunds from NELFUND for fees they had already paid. These students, who had applied and qualified for the education loan, spoke to UTV about their experiences with the process and how they felt about the Federal Government’s initiative to ease the financial burden of higher education.
The excitement and relief were evident, as students praised the transparency and efficiency of the refund process. Many described the NELFUND initiative as a game-changer for youths seeking access to education without the weight of immediate financial strain.

In a related development, Michael Okpara University of Agriculture, Umudike (MOUAU) announced that 580 students have successfully received a total of ₦71,000,000 from NELFUND.
The Vice Chancellor of MOUAU, Professor Maduebibisi Ofo Iwe, confirmed the disbursement and expressed gratitude to NELFUND for supporting students in need. He encouraged other students to apply for the loan, emphasizing the university’s commitment to student welfare and academic excellence.
According to the institution’s management, additional lists of students have been submitted to NELFUND for subsequent disbursements.
